ICT 시대에서 게임놀이활동이 학령기 지적장애아동의 뇌파와 사회적 기술, 자기 통제력에 미치는 영향

The Effects of Game Play Activities on the EEG, Social Skills and the Self-control of the Children with Intellectual Disabilities in ICT era

초록

본 연구는 게임놀이활동이 학령기 지적장애아동의 주의력관련 뇌파, 사회적 기술, 자기 통제력에 미치는 영향을 알아보고자 하였다. 본 연구의 대상자는 지적장애로 진단 받은 학령기 아동 6명으로 게임놀이활동을 주 2회, 50분씩 총 12회기 실시하였다. 연구결과 게임놀이활동을 받은 실험군(p<.05)에서 중재 후 주의력 관련 뇌파(알파파, 베타파)와 사회적 기술, 자기 통제력 모두 유의하게 향상되었다. 실험군과 대조군의 집단 간 비교에서는 주의력 관련 뇌파중 알파파와 사회적 기술, 자기 통제력에서 실험군이 대조군보다 의미 있는 변화를 보여주었으며(p<.05), 베타파에서는 집단 간 변화의 차이가 없었다(p>.05). 이처럼 게임놀이활동은 지적장애 아동이 흥미롭게 자발적으로 참여할 수 있다는 점에서 지적장애 아동을 이해하고 문제의 예방과 치료에 보다 효과적으로 활용 될 수 있다.

The purpose of this study was to investigate the effects of game play activities on EEG, social skills and self-control in the children with intellectual disabilities. Subjects with intellectual disabilties were divided by control group(n=3) and the experimental group(n=3). In a period of 6 weeks, they took game play activities for 50 minutes 2 times a week. As a result, in EEG(${\alpha}$-wave, ${\beta}$-wave), social skills and self-control before and after intervention, there were significant difference in experimental group(p<.05). And in ${\alpha}$-wave, social skills and self-control, there were significant difference in between group(p<.05). But, in ${\beta}$-wave there was no significant difference in between group(p>.05). These findings indicate that game play activities on the children with intellectual disabilities could improve EEG, social skills and self-control. Accordingly, game play activities are judged to be used for the children with intellectual disabilities to prevent problem and to intervention.
